Analysis

Trinidad and Tobago recorded 124.67 kt for carbon stock change in forests — net emissions/removals (co2) in 2025. That is the lowest value across all 36 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 5.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, carbon stock change in forests — net emissions/removals (co2) in Trinidad and Tobago peaked at 132 kt in 2011 and was at its lowest, 124.67 kt, in 2001.

Trinidad and Tobago ranks 66th of 223 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ions from Forests consists of CO2 emissions and removals corresponding to forest carbon stock changes (aboveground and belowground living biomass). Estimates are computed following the 2006 IPCC Guidelines for National Greenhouse Gas Inventories (IPCC, 2006).
